In an exciting leap towards simplifying cryptocurrency transactions, Visa, the global payments giant, has introduced an innovative feature that allows users to pay Ethereum transaction gas fees using their credit cards. This move is poised to make cryptocurrency engagement more accessible and user-friendly for a broader audience, bridging the gap between traditional financial systems and the dynamic crypto sphere.
Traditionally, navigating Ethereum transactions has been complex due to the requirement of paying gas fees in cryptocurrency. This could be a deterrent for newcomers to the crypto landscape. However, Visa’s groundbreaking approach eliminates this obstacle. Users can now seamlessly employ their credit cards to cover gas fees, ushering in a new era of convenience.
By enabling credit card payments for gas fees, Visa demonstrates its commitment to driving the mainstream adoption of cryptocurrencies. The integration of a familiar and widely accepted payment method paves the way for a more extensive user base, many of whom may have been deterred by the intricacies of crypto transactions.
